Ofsted equivalents? by sparklychar in TeachingUK

[–]MrsD12345 8 points9 points  (0 children)

I did a year teaching in the US and no mentioned any equivalent, but teachers had to recertify every few years and needed X amount of CPD hours to do so. Seemed like a sensible way of ensuring that knowledge was updated and maintained.
